How To Choose The Right 7 1 4 Circular Saw Blades
Tooth Count Sets The Mood Of The Cut
Tooth count is the first place you should focus, because it tells you a lot about how the blade will behave. Lower counts around 24 teeth move quickly through framing lumber, while 40T gives you a middle path for general woodworking and 140T leans into smoother edges for trim and cabinet work.
That trade-off matters in real life. Fast cuts save time on rough build days, but fine teeth leave a cleaner surface that needs less sanding or cleanup.
Blade Material Changes Durability And Feel
Steel blades are straightforward and often easier to live with for basic jobs, while carbide-tipped blades usually hold their edge longer. Carbide is a harder cutting material, so it tends to make more sense for anyone cutting often or working through a long project list.
The catch is that tougher materials usually sit in a more specialized lane. For a one-off weekend job, a simpler blade can be enough, but repeated use starts to favor carbide.
Match The Blade To The Material, Not The Label
Wood, plywood, laminate, aluminum, plastic, and metal each ask for a different tooth pattern and cutting style. A blade built for wood can stumble on metal, and a metal blade rarely feels right on trim carpentry.
That’s why the best choice depends on the surface in front of you. A mixed-home-project blade helps with versatility, while a material-specific blade usually rewards you with a cleaner result on its own turf.
Compatibility And Cleanup Still Matter
The arbor, which is the center hole that fits your saw, needs to match your tool before anything else. Common sizes like 5/8 inch appear often, but the blade still has to suit the saw you own.
After that, maintenance is mostly about cleaning pitch, wiping off dust, and storing the blade dry. That small habit helps the edge stay ready, especially on finer blades that can dull faster in messy storage.

Mistakes Worth Dodging
Many people grab the wrong tooth count first, then wonder why the cut feels slow or rough. Another common miss is choosing a wood blade for metal or a finish blade for framing, which usually leads to frustration and extra cleanup.
Arbor fit gets overlooked too. A blade can look right on paper and still be wrong for the saw sitting on your bench.
The Upgrade Payoff
Higher-tier blades often cost more because carbide teeth, anti-stick coatings, vibration control, and more refined tooth geometry take more manufacturing care. Those details matter most on long project days, where steadier tracking and cleaner edges save time later.
For trim carpentry, cabinetry, and repeated shop use, the upgrade can feel justified pretty quickly. For occasional rough cuts, a simpler blade often does enough without adding extra cost.
Frequently Asked Questions
What tooth count works best for fast wood cuts?
A 24T blade usually fits that role well. It moves through lumber faster than finer blades, though the edge will be rougher.
What tooth count suits finish carpentry?
140T blades are the cleaner-cut option in this list. They work better on visible edges, trim, and panel work.
Why does carbide matter?
Carbide teeth are harder than plain steel teeth. That usually helps the blade hold its edge longer during repeated use.
What does arbor size mean?
The arbor is the center opening that mounts the blade onto the saw. The blade needs to match your saw’s arbor size for proper fit.
Can one blade handle every material?
Not well, and that’s usually where frustration starts. Wood, metal, aluminum, plastic, and laminate each do better with a blade tuned to that material.
